What does Putin think about JFK?

The Chicken Hawk conveys his take on Vladimir Putin’s JFK comments:

“In an interview with NBC’s Megyn Kelly, Russian President Vladimir Putin said:

“There’s a theory that Kennedy’s assassination was arranged by the United States intelligence services. So, if this theory is correct and that can’t be ruled out, then what could be easier, in this day and age, than using all the technical means at the disposal of the intelligence services, and using those means to organize some attacks – and then pointing the finger at Russia.”

“He continued:

“I will tell you something that you probably already know. I don’t want to hurt anyone’s feelings, but the United States, everywhere, all over the world, actively interferes with electoral campaigns of other countries. Put your finger anywhere on a map of the world and everywhere you will hear complaints that American officials are interfering in internal electoral processes.”

“When Putin says that the theory that Kennedy’s assassination was arranged by the United States intelligence services can’t be ruled out, he’s telling us: that’s what happened.”

My two cents: Putin is an capricious autocrat but you can’t say he’s not astute about geopolitics. I think his formulation is accurate: the possibility of an U.S. intelligence service plot against JFK cannot be ruled out.
